One reason might be that you need to shell out $99 every year to be allowed to publish official Safari extensions. It is, theoretically, possible to distribute without the App Store, but users need to activate Developer mode and do quite a few manual steps. It's not a click (or drag and drop) like FF and Chromium Based browsers. |
